Dynamic

OpenStreetMap vs Pre-built Maps

Developers should learn OpenStreetMap when building location-based applications, GIS systems, or services requiring custom or up-to-date map data, as it offers a free alternative to proprietary mapping services like Google Maps meets developers should use pre-built maps when they need to quickly add mapping capabilities to applications, such as for location-based services, logistics, real estate, or travel apps, as they save time and resources compared to developing custom mapping solutions. Here's our take.

🧊Nice Pick

OpenStreetMap

Developers should learn OpenStreetMap when building location-based applications, GIS systems, or services requiring custom or up-to-date map data, as it offers a free alternative to proprietary mapping services like Google Maps

OpenStreetMap

Nice Pick

Developers should learn OpenStreetMap when building location-based applications, GIS systems, or services requiring custom or up-to-date map data, as it offers a free alternative to proprietary mapping services like Google Maps

Pros

  • +It is particularly useful for projects in regions with limited commercial map coverage, humanitarian efforts, or applications needing detailed, community-driven data such as pedestrian paths or local points of interest
  • +Related to: geographic-information-systems, leaflet

Cons

  • -Specific tradeoffs depend on your use case

Pre-built Maps

Developers should use pre-built maps when they need to quickly add mapping capabilities to applications, such as for location-based services, logistics, real estate, or travel apps, as they save time and resources compared to developing custom mapping solutions

Pros

  • +They are essential for handling complex geographic data, providing up-to-date map tiles, and ensuring cross-platform compatibility, making them ideal for projects requiring reliable, scalable, and user-friendly map interfaces without deep expertise in GIS (Geographic Information Systems)
  • +Related to: google-maps-api, mapbox

Cons

  • -Specific tradeoffs depend on your use case

The Verdict

These tools serve different purposes. OpenStreetMap is a platform while Pre-built Maps is a tool. We picked OpenStreetMap based on overall popularity, but your choice depends on what you're building.

🧊
The Bottom Line
OpenStreetMap wins

Based on overall popularity. OpenStreetMap is more widely used, but Pre-built Maps excels in its own space.

Disagree with our pick? nice@nicepick.dev